Overview
The DAH-339 is a high quality three channel 3G/HD/SD Reclocking Distribution Amplifier. It is
capable of equalizing and reclocking three channels in 3G, HD or SD.
The DAH-339 can equalize and reclock incoming SDI signals using up to 300m of cable at 270 Mbps,
up to 120m of cable at 1.485 Gbps, and up to 80m at 2.97Gbps.
One channel of ASI can be reclocked and output for each of the SDI inputs. The BNC’s that output a
non-inverted signal suitable for ASI are BNCs #4, 5, and 8.
